AFN hopes to have Okinawa 648 AM station back on the air by September.
By Matthew M. Burke, Stars and Stripes, 27 July 2023. Camp Kinser, Okinawa.

Fans of talk radio and NPR on American Forces Network must wait a little longer while further repairs are
made to a faulty tower and supporting equipment on Okinawa. Surf 648 AM — sister station to Wave 89.1 FM — went off the air March 21 so crews could fix a support wire for the station’s radio tower, AFN spokesman John Clearwater said in April. The work was expected to be completed by June 1.

While making repairs, contractor KBR Inc. discovered “severe” corrosion on a transformer, which regulates and conducts electricity to the tower, according to a Tuesday email from Keith Smith, chief of operations for AFN Pacific. The network hopes to have the AM channel back online by early September.
“AFN Okinawa’s Camp Kinser AM Tower is nearly complete,” Clearwater said by email Friday. “Our AFN Pacific Technical Service crews are working to fully restore AM service to the Okinawa community on AM Surf 648 as soon as possible.”
